Colin Trevvorow who directed the first Jurassic World and co-wrote the sequel (Fallen Kingdom) has tweeted out a little Jurassic World 2 teaser. It is only five seconds long and features Chris Pratt snuggling with a baby raptor.
It potentially tells us that whilst the original Jurassic World was quite frantic and all about Dino-killing action, maybe the sequel will have some more gentle moments like the original Jurassic Park.

Previously, Trevvorow had spoken a little bit about how Jurassic World 2 will differ from any Jurassic Park movie to come before it.
“We never imagined what happens when this technology goes open source. I think the minute that you add an idea like that into something like this it can open up the minds of every young person who loved these movies. I think there’s a lot room to grow.”
Jurassic World 2 is due to release in theatres on the 22nd of June, 2018. It’s going to be a long way, but boy, it’s going to be good.
